Description
In the years 1891 and 1892, the Gütermann family built a brewery in Saalfeld that was modern from the perspective of the time. During the last days of the war the brewery was completely destroyed. But the brewery was quickly rebuild; from 1948 to 1991 the brewery was state-owned. At the time of the reunification of Germany in 1989, the brewery was in a technically completely outdated condition. In 1991 the brewery became a private company. After large investments the Bürgerliche Brauhaus Saalfeld became a modern brewery. A share of 23% is owned by Kulmbacher Brauerei AG.
